Renewal Process

License renewal for Speech-Language Pathologist professionals in Oklahoma occurs on a 2-year cycle. OK charges a renewal fee of $200 and mandates continuing education as part of the renewal process. It is recommended to begin the renewal process in Oklahoma at least 60 days before your license expires to ensure uninterrupted practice.
